He is pointing out that many people used two or three forms of their names
in period, just as we do today. (Depending on where I am, I am John Rudin,
Jay Rudin, or J. Frank Rudin, and "Frank" isn't even my middle name.)
Also, spelling was not yet regularized, and there was no such thing as a
"correct" spelling.
Therefore, he is trying to show people that our concern for a single exact
spelling is inauthentic.
Of course, the large number of spellings and variants he's using is just as
inauthentic as restricting it to only one, so the example fails on any
level other than humor or irony, but it's not news to Daniel or anyone else
that heralds tend to go overboard.
